Cullman VB qualifies for 6A North Regional:

Cullman finishes 2nd in 6A, Area 13 after victory in semifinal round:

GDW Analysis:

 JASPER: Cullman volleyball was winless in 4 matches from AHSAA Class 6A, Area 13 in the regular season.
A different story took place Friday in a semifinal battle with Mortimer Jordan.
Cullman claimed victory 3 games to 1. It served as their ticket to return to the North Regional for the 2nd straight year under coach Amy Hudson.
Jasper would defeat Cullman in the championship Friday evening.
But the first task was to extend the season in which the Lady Bearcats have despite only 12 victories to show for.
Cullman joins locals Vinemont, Holly Pond and Good Hope into the regional round.
Vinemont won 3A, Area 11 over Holly Pond and Good Hope claimed 2nd in 4A, Area 13 to West Morgan.
The Lady 'Cats will face Area 11 winner Oxford in the opening round of the regional from the Finley Center.
Dates and match times have not been set by the AHSAA as of Saturday afternoon.
The winner of Cullman/Oxford gets the winner of Mt. Brook/Buckhorn in the quarterfinals.
On the lower side of the bracket, Area 13 winner Jasper plays Pell City. That winner sees the winner of Hazel Green/Huffman in the Round of 8.
